== In the background ==
If someone uploads a document, a ccl is created with the document and the following changesin the CDA:
* EFU - CCLId In is set to the CCL created for the upload
* EFU - DateTime In is set to the datetime of the CCL
 
== Limiting by type ==
 
 
It is also possible to limit the types of file accepted. This is done by editing the Answer Values
 
 
[[File:efu_011.png|800px]]
 
 
Using # separated values you can add the file types you want to limit by. If left blank, the default set will always be gif#jpg#png#pdf
